Utiliser le réseau de distribution de contenu Office 365 avec SharePoint Online

Remarque :  Nous faisons de notre mieux pour vous fournir le contenu d’aide le plus récent aussi rapidement que possible dans votre langue. Cette page a été traduite automatiquement et peut donc contenir des erreurs grammaticales ou des imprécisions. Notre objectif est de faire en sorte que ce contenu vous soit utile. Pouvez-vous nous indiquer en bas de page si ces informations vous ont aidé ? Voici l’article en anglais à des fins de référence aisée.

Vous pouvez héberger statiques actifs dans le réseau de distribution de contenu Office 365 (CDN ) pour améliorer les performances de vos pages SharePoint Online. Biens statiques sont des fichiers qui ne changent pas très souvent, tels que des images, vidéo et audio, les feuilles de style, polices et fichiers JavaScript. La CDN fonctionne comme un proxy de mise en cache géographiquement, en mettant en cache statiques actifs rapprocher pour les navigateurs les demandant.

Si vous connaissez déjà la manière que travail CDN, vous seulement devez effectuer quelques étapes sont nécessaires pour configurer votre messagerie. Cette rubrique décrit comment. Poursuivez votre lecture pour plus d’informations sur la Office 365 CDN et la prise en main d’hébergement de vos biens statiques.

Revenez à planification réseau et optimisation des performances pour Office 365.   

Fonctions élémentaires de CDN Office 365

Le Office 365 CDN est inclus dans le cadre de votre abonnement SharePoint Online. Vous n’êtes pas obligé de payer supplémentaires. Office 365 fournit une prise en charge pour les deux privés et accès public et vous permet de biens statique hôte dans plusieurs emplacements ou origines. Le Office 365 CDN n’est pas différente de celle du Azure CDN. Si vous avez besoin de plus d’informations sur les raisons d’utiliser un CDN ou sur les concepts général CDN, voir réseaux de distribution de contenu.

Comment la CDN accorde l’accès aux utilisateurs finaux

Accès privé aux éléments statiques dans l' Office 365 CDN est autorisé par jetons générés par SharePoint Online. Les utilisateurs qui ont déjà autorisé à accéder au dossier ou bibliothèque désignée par l’origine hériteront automatiquement jetons. SharePoint Online ne prend pas en charge autorisations au niveau de l’élément pour le CDN.

Par exemple, pour un fichier situé dans https://contoso.sharepoint.com/sites/site1/library1/folder1/image1.jpg, étant donné les éléments suivants :

  • Utilisateur 1 a accès au dossier 1 et à image1.jpg

  • L’utilisateur 2 n’a pas accès au dossier 1

  • Utilisateur 3 n’a pas accès au dossier 1 mais est accordé l’autorisation explicite d’accéder aux image1.jpg via SharePoint Online

  • Utilisateur 4 a accès au dossier 1 mais a été explicitement refusé accès à image1.jpg

Puis les conditions suivantes sont remplies :

  • Utilisateur 1 et 4 de l’utilisateur sera en mesure d’accéder aux image1.jpg via le CDN.

  • L’utilisateur 2 et 3 de l’utilisateur ne seront pas en mesure d’accéder aux image1.jpg via le CDN.

    Toutefois, utilisateur 3 peuvent toujours accéder à la image1.jpg biens directement via SharePoint Online tandis que 4 de l’utilisateur ne peut pas accéder à la ressource via SharePoint Online.

Vue d’ensemble de l’utilisation de la CDN 365 Office

Pour configurer le Office 365 CDN, que vous suivez ces étapes de base :

Une fois terminé avec le programme d’installation, gérer le CDN 365 Office au fil du temps en :

  • Ajout, mise à jour et suppression d’actifs

  • Ajout et suppression d’origines

  • Configuration des stratégies de CDN

  • Si nécessaire, désactivation de l' Office 365 CDN

Déterminer l’endroit où vous voulez stocker vos ressources

La CDN extrait vos biens à partir d’un emplacement appelé une origine. Pour Office 365, une origine est une bibliothèque SharePoint ou un dossier accessible par une URL. Vous avez une grande flexibilité lorsque vous spécifiez origines pour votre organisation. Par exemple, vous pouvez spécifier plusieurs origines ou un seul origin dans laquelle vous voulez insérer tous vos actifs CDN. Vous pouvez choisir origines publics ou privés pour votre organisation. La plupart des organisations choisiront de mise en œuvre d’une combinaison des deux.

Si vous définissez des centaines d’origines, il aura un impact négatif sur le temps que nécessaire pour traiter les demandes. Nous vous recommandons que si vous avez plus de 100 origines vous souhaiterez peut-être concevoir de nouveau votre architecture.

Choisissez si chaque origine doit être public ou privé

Lorsque vous identifiez une origine, vous spécifiez s’il doit être rendu public ou privé. Quelle que soit l’option que vous choisissez, Microsoft fait l’essentiel pour vous lorsqu’il s’agit de l’administration de la CDN lui-même. Vous pouvez également, changez d’avis ultérieurement, une fois que vous avez configuré la CDN et identifié votre origines.

Options publiques et privées améliorent les performances, mais chacune présente des avantages et des attributs uniques.

Attributs et les avantages de l’hébergement actifs dans une origine publique   

  • Actifs présentés dans une origine publique sont accessibles par tout le monde manière anonyme.

    Important : Si vous identifiez une publique origine dans votre CDN, vous devez placer jamais ressources qui sont considérés comme sensibles à votre organisation dans une origine public ou une bibliothèque SharePoint Online.

  • Si vous supprimez une ressource d’une origine publique, les biens peuvent continuer à être disponibles pendant 30 jours à partir du cache ; Toutefois, nous invalide des liens vers les biens dans le CDN dans les 15 minutes.

  • Lorsque vous hébergez des feuilles de style (fichiers CSS) dans une origine publique, vous pouvez utiliser les chemins d’accès relatifs et MU au sein du code. Cela signifie que vous pouvez faire référence à l’emplacement des images d’arrière-plan et d’autres objets par rapport à l’emplacement de l’actif qui est l’appel.

  • Pendant que vous pouvez coder URL d’une origine public, cela est donc pas recommandé. La raison est que si l’accès à la CDN devient indisponible, l’URL ne résout pas automatiquement à votre organisation dans SharePoint Online et peut entraîner des liens rompus ou d’autres erreurs.

  • Les types de fichier par défaut qui sont inclus pour les origines publics sont .css, .eot, .gif, .ico, .jpeg, .jpg, .js, .map, .png, .svg, .ttf et .woff. Vous pouvez spécifier les types de fichiers supplémentaires.

  • Si vous le souhaitez, vous pouvez configurer une stratégie pour exclure les éléments qui ont été identifiées par classifications de site que vous spécifiez. Par exemple, vous pouvez choisir exclure tous les éléments marqués comme « confidentiel » ou « restreint » même s’ils sont un type de fichier autorisé et se trouvent dans une origine publique.

Attributs et les avantages de l’hébergement actifs dans une origine privée   

  • Les utilisateurs peuvent accéder uniquement les biens à partir d’une origine privée qu’ils sont autorisés à le faire. L’accès anonyme à ces actifs ne peut pas.

  • Si vous supprimez un bien à l’origine privé, les biens peuvent continuer à être disponible pour devenir une heure à partir du cache ; Toutefois, nous invalide des liens vers les biens dans le CDN dans les 15 minutes.

  • Les types de fichier par défaut qui sont inclus pour les origines privés sont .gif, .ico, .jpeg, .jpg, .js et .png. Vous pouvez spécifier les types de fichiers supplémentaires.

  • Comme origines publics, vous pouvez configurer une stratégie pour exclure les éléments qui ont été identifiées par classifications de site que vous spécifiez même si vous utilisez des caractères génériques pour inclure tous les éléments dans un dossier ou une bibliothèque de Site.

Par défaut Office 365 CDN origines

Sauf indication contraire, Office 365 configure certains origines par défaut pour vous lorsque vous activez le Office 365 CDN. Si vous les excluez initiale, vous pouvez ajouter ces origines après avoir terminé le programme d’installation.

Origines privés par défaut :

  • */userphoto.aspx

  • * / siteassets

Origines publics par défaut :

  • * / gabarit

  • * / bibliothèque de styles

Installer et configurer le Office 365 CDN à l’aide de SharePoint Online Management Shell

Les procédures décrites dans cette rubrique nécessitent d’utiliser SharePoint Online Management Shell pour vous connecter à SharePoint Online. Pour obtenir des instructions, voir se connecter à SharePoint Online PowerShell.

Complétez ces étapes pour installer et configurer le Office 365 CDN pour héberger vos ressources statiques dans SharePoint Online.

Pour activer votre organisation d’utiliser le Office 365 CDN

Utiliser l’applet de commande Set-SPOTenantCdnEnabled pour activer votre organisation d’utiliser le Office 365 CDN. Vous pouvez activer votre organisation d’utiliser origines publics, origines privés ou les deux avec la CDN. Vous pouvez également configurer la Office 365 CDN pour ignorer la configuration des origines par défaut lorsque vous l’activez. Vous pouvez toujours ajouter ces origines ultérieurement, comme décrit dans cette rubrique.

Dans Windows Powershell pour SharePoint Online :

Set-SPOTenantCdnEnabled -CdnType <Public | Private | Both> -Enable $true

Par exemple, pour permettre à votre organisation d’utiliser origines publiques et privées avec la CDN, tapez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Both -Enable $true

Pour permettre à votre organisation d’utiliser origines publiques et privées avec la CDN mais ignorer la configuration les origines par défaut, tapez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Both -Enable $true -NoDefaultOrigins

Pour permettre à votre organisation d’utiliser publics origines avec la CDN, tapez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Public -Enable $true

Pour permettre à votre organisation d’utiliser origines privés avec la CDN, tapez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Private -Enable $true

Pour plus d’informations sur cette applet de commande, voir Set-SPOTenantCdnEnabled.

(Facultatif) Pour modifier la liste des types de fichiers à inclure dans le Office 365 CDN

Conseil : Lorsque vous définissez des types de fichiers à l’aide de l’applet de commande Set-SPOTenantCdnPolicy , vous remplacez la liste actuellement définie. Si vous souhaitez ajouter d’autres types de fichiers à la liste, utilisez d’abord l’applet de commande pour déterminer les types de fichiers sont déjà autorisés et les incluent dans la liste ainsi que les nouvelles.

Utiliser l’applet de commande Set-SPOTenantCdnPolicy pour définir les types de fichiers statique qui peuvent être hébergés par origines publiques et privées dans la CDN. Par défaut, les types de biens courants sont autorisés, pour .js, .gif, .jpg et exemple .css.

Dans Windows PowerShell pour SharePoint Online :

Set-SPOTenantCdnPolicy -CdnType <Public | Private> -PolicyType IncludeFileExtensions -PolicyValue "<Comma-separated list of file types>"

Pour voir quels types de fichiers ne sont actuellement autorisées par la CDN, utilisez l’applet de commande Get-SPOTenantCdnPolicies :

Get-SPOTenantCdnPolicies -CdnType <Public | Private>

Pour plus d’informations sur ces applets de commande, voir Set-SPOTenantCdnPolicy et Get-SPOTenantCdnPolicies.

(Facultatif) Pour modifier la liste des catégories de site que vous voulez exclure de la Office 365 CDN

Conseil : Lorsque vous permet d’exclure les classifications de site à l’aide de l’applet de commande Set-SPOTenantCdnPolicy , vous remplacez la liste actuellement définie. Si vous voulez exclure les classifications de sites supplémentaires, utilisez tout d’abord l’applet de commande pour déterminer quelles classifications sont déjà exclues, puis ajoutez-les ainsi que les nouvelles.

Utiliser l’applet de commande Set-SPOTenantCdnPolicy pour exclure les classifications de site que vous ne souhaitez pas mettre à disposition sur le CDN. Par défaut, aucune classification site n’est exclues.

Dans Windows PowerShell pour SharePoint Online :

Set-SPOTenantCdnPolicy -CdnType <Public | Private> -PolicyType ExcludeRestrictedSiteClassifications  -PolicyValue "<Comma-separated list of site classifications>"

Pour savoir quelles classifications de site sont actuellement restreintes, utilisez l’applet de commande Get-SPOTenantCdnPolicies :

Get-SPOTenantCdnPolicies -CdnType <Public | Private>

Pour plus d’informations sur ces applets de commande, voir Set-SPOTenantCdnPolicy et Get-SPOTenantCdnPolicies.

Pour ajouter une origine pour vos ressources

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ir une origine. Vous pouvez définir plusieurs origines. L’origine est une URL qui pointe vers une bibliothèque SharePoint ou un dossier qui contient les éléments que vous souhaitez être hébergé par le CDN.

Important : Si vous identifiez une publique origine dans votre CDN, vous devez placer jamais ressources qui sont considérés comme sensibles à votre organisation dans l’origine public ou une bibliothèque SharePoint Online.

Add-SPOTenantCdnOrigin -CdnType <Public | Private> -OriginUrl <path>

Où chemin d’accès est le chemin d’accès au dossier qui contient les biens. Vous pouvez utiliser des caractères génériques en plus des chemins d’accès relatifs. Par exemple, pour inclure toutes les ressources dans le dossier masterpages pour l’ensemble de vos sites comme une origine publique au sein de la CDN, tapez la commande suivante :

Add-SPOTenantCdnOrigin -CdnType Public -OriginUrl */masterpage

Pour plus d’informations sur cette commande et sa syntaxe, voir Ajouter SPOTenantCdnOrigin.

Une fois que vous avez exécuté la commande, le système synchronise la configuration au sein du centre de données. Cela prend 15 minutes.

Exemple : Configuration d’un public origin de vos pages maîtres et des votre bibliothèque de styles pour SharePoint Online

En règle générale, ces origines sont configurés pour vous par défaut lorsque vous activez origines publics pour le CDN 365 Office. Toutefois, si vous souhaitez les activer manuellement, procédez comme suit.

  •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ir la bibliothèque de styles comme une origine publique au sein de l' Office 365 CDN.

    Add-SPOTenantCdnOrigin -CdnType Public -OriginUrl */style%20library
  •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ir les pages maîtres comme une origine publique au sein de l' Office 365 CDN.

    Add-SPOTenantCdnOrigin -CdnType Public -OriginUrl */masterpage
  • Pour plus d’informations sur cette commande et sa syntaxe, voir Ajouter SPOTenantCdnOrigin.

    Une fois que vous avez exécuté la commande, le système synchronise la configuration au sein du centre de données. Cela prend 15 minutes.

Exemple : Configuration d’une origine privée pour vos éléments de site, pages de site et des images de publication pour SharePoint Online

  •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ir le dossier éléments de site comme une origine privée au sein de l' Office 365 CDN.

    Add-SPOTenantCdnOrigin -CdnType Private -OriginUrl */siteassets
  •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ir le dossier de pages de site comme une origine privée au sein de l' Office 365 CDN.

    Add-SPOTenantCdnOrigin -CdnType Private -OriginUrl */sitepages
  •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ir le dossier images publication comme une origine privée au sein de l' Office 365 CDN.

    Add-SPOTenantCdnOrigin -CdnType Private -OriginUrl */publishingimages

    Pour plus d’informations sur cette commande et sa syntaxe, voir Ajouter SPOTenantCdnOrigin.

    Une fois que vous avez exécuté la commande, le système synchronise la configuration au sein du centre de données. Cela prend 15 minutes.

Exemple : Configuration d’une origine privée pour une collection de sites pour SharePoint Online

Utiliser l’applet de commande Add-SPOTenantCdnOrigin pour définir une collection de sites comme une origine privée au sein de l' Office 365 CDN. Par exemple,

Add-SPOTenantCdnOrigin -CdnType Private -OriginUrl sites/site1/siteassets

Pour plus d’informations sur cette commande et sa syntaxe, voir Ajouter SPOTenantCdnOrigin.

Une fois que vous avez exécuté la commande, le système synchronise la configuration au sein du centre de données. Cela prend 15 minutes.

Gérer la Office 365 CDN

Une fois que vous avez configuré la CDN, vous pouvez apporter des modifications à votre configuration que vous mettez à jour le contenu ou selon l’évolution de vos besoins, comme décrit dans cette section.

Pour ajouter, mettre à jour ou supprimer des éléments à partir de l' Office 365 CDN

Une fois que vous avez terminé les étapes de configuration, vous pouvez ajouter de nouvelles ressources et mettre à jour ou supprimer des ressources existantes dès que vous le souhaitez. Effectuez vos modifications pour les biens dans le dossier ou la bibliothèque SharePoint que vous avez identifiés comme origine. Si vous ajoutez un nouvel actif, il est disponible via le CDN immédiatement. Toutefois, si vous mettez à jour l’actif, vous devrez patienter jusqu'à 15 minutes pour que la nouvelle copie se propager et deviennent disponibles dans la CDN.

Si vous avez besoin récupérer l’emplacement d’origine, vous pouvez utiliser l’applet de commande Get-SPOTenantCdnOrigins . Pour plus d’informations sur l’utilisation de cette applet de commande, voir Get-SPOTenantCdnOrigins.

Pour supprimer une origine de l' Office 365 CDN

Si vous le souhaitez, vous pouvez supprimer l’accès à un dossier ou une bibliothèque SharePoint que vous avez identifiés comme origine. Pour ce faire, utilisez l’applet de commande Remove-SPOTenantCdnOrigin . Pour plus d’informations sur l’utilisation de cette applet de commande, voir Supprimer SPOTenantCdnOrigin.

Pour modifier une origine dans l' Office 365 CDN

Vous ne pouvez pas modifier une origine que vous avez créé. À la place, supprimer l’origine, puis ajoutez une nouvelle visualisation. Pour plus d’informations, consultez Supprimer une origine à partir du CDN 365 Office et pour ajouter une origine pour vos ressources.

Pour désactiver le Office 365 CDN

Utiliser l’applet de commande Set-SPOTenantCdnEnabled pour désactiver la CDN pour votre organisation. Si vous avez à la fois les origines privées et activées pour la CDN, vous devez exécuter l’applet de commande à deux reprises comme indiqué dans les exemples suivants.

Pour désactiver l’utilisation des origines publics dans la CDN, dans Windows Powershell pour SharePoint Online, entrez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Public -Enable $false

Pour désactiver l’utilisation des origines privés dans la CDN, entrez la commande suivante :

Set-SPOTenantCdnEnabled -CdnType Private -Enable $false

Pour plus d’informations sur cette applet de commande, voir Set-SPOTenantCdnEnabled.

Résolution des problèmes de configuration de votre CDN Office 365

Le point de terminaison immédiatement sera pas disponible pour une utilisation, comme le temps requis pour l’enregistrement à propager dans le CDN. Configuration prend 15 minutes.

Développez vos compétences dans Office
Découvrez des formations
Accédez aux nouvelles fonctionnalités en avant-première
Rejoignez le programme Office Insider

Ces informations vous ont-elles été utiles ?

Nous vous remercions pour vos commentaires.

Merci pour vos commentaires. Il serait vraisemblablement utile pour vous de contacter l’un de nos agents du support Office.

×